Instruction: Robert E. Ward, JD, LL.M., is a nationally recognized authority on tax, business and estate planning. Mr. Ward teaches law as an adjunct professor at the George Mason University School of Law where he has conducted classes in Estate and Gift Taxation, Estate Planning, and Business Planning since 1986. He has also taught as an adjunct faculty member at the University of Baltimore School of Law: Fiduciary Income Taxation (1988) and at Golden Gate University's Masters in Taxation Program: Taxation of Corporations and Shareholders (1982)
